listen to the proctors... they were pretty nice, but they want their instructions followed exactly!!!
as long as you practiced you will do fine...
allways write down the SP's name so you can remember it1 I 1 and use it during the history
allways tell the SP what your are going to do
allways maintain eye contact with the SP
but above all - be nice!!!

by the way ram 3. for ck, depending on the score you want i suggest read kaplan books 3 x, then start kapan qbank in timed, unused mode, only do one blocvk per day and then at night go over evry single question whether right or wrong in detail, write notes about it. then once you finish that take your nbme. keep reading kapkan books for weak areas and read first aid 3 x and secrets twice, once your done qith kaplan qbank do the usmle world questions in the same mode. i suggest kaplan qbank first because they are easier but if you begin with usmle world you will spoil your learning process from very good to ok, that way you go from ok to very good, on test day, focus and be confident if you get over 500 on nbme your mre than ready over a 450 is god enough too, i socred a 90 and i was socring a 490 4 weeks before my exam. study hard and youll do great, consider it a marathon the harder you study the more points you get. good luck...
